Explanation

For Benzoic Acid, g/L is the base reference and molar mass is 122.123 g/mol. ppm -> g/L via the dilute aqueous approximation: 1 ppm ~= 1 mg/l. g/L -> mmol/L via the uses solute molar mass with si milli scaling. Combined factor: 1 ppm = 0.00818846572718 mmol/L. Benzoic Acid keeps one fixed solution-concentration basis, so the snapshot, calculator, common values, and mirror route stay aligned.
